Click Start, type aero in the Start Search box, and then click Find and fix problems with transparency and other visual effects.
A wizard window opens. Click Advanced if you want the problem fixed automatically, and then click Next to continue. If the problem is automatically fixed, the window borders are translucent. I don't know if this completely disables Aero Peek but you can try this: Right click on the taskbar and go to Properties. Clear the checkbox for: Use Aero Peek to preview the desktop Search for "Adjust performance and appearance in Windows" with the Start Menu Uncheck the boxes that have to do with Aero Peek or Aero or just check Adjust for best performance which should completely remove any elements of Aero in Windows Additionally: in Personalization, are you using the basic theme instead of the Normal Windows 10 theme?
